KompoZer / Nvu » Skabelon, css og at linke

maikenjh
 

Skabelon, css og at linke

Indlægaf maikenjh » tors 12. aug 2010 11:10

Jeg har hentet Kompozer for et par dage siden og er helt grøn i at lave hjemmesider - der er derfor en del at lære.
Jeg har valgt at hente en gratis template fra en af dine links og har fundet ud af at lave kopier af templaten, hvorefter de kan gemmes som hver sin side i min hjemmeside (jeg startede nemlig med at overskrive igen og igen, så der lærte jeg lidt). Nu har jeg så rettet i teksten i tre sider og er kommet i tanke om at det måske var en god ide at bruge css idet jeg f.eks. ønsker at skabelonen på alle sider er en smule bredere. Er det her jeg skal bruge ekstern css og kan jeg bruge det efter jeg har rettet/ lavet teksten til de første tre sider? Er der et sted hvor jeg kan lære om brugen af css til skabeloner/ og andre sider?
Ud over det så har jeg problemer med at linke siderne til hinanden. Kan det passe at i den rullemenu der popper op (når jeg prøver at linke) ikke indeholder de andre sider? Siderne er jo også gemt seperat, så det er vel ikke lige sådan for Kompozer at finde dem. Du skriver på Ludvigs hjørne at: "Ankre kan også benyttes, når du linker til en anden side. I så fald skal du skrive adressen på siden, efterfulgt af # og ankrets navn. Linket kan fx se sådan ud: http://kimludvigsen.dk/tips-internet-we ... hp#firefox. .....Men jeg har jo ikke noget navn til hjemmesiden endnu, betyder det så at jeg skal vente med at linke til den er oprettet? (Husk at jeg er HELT grøn :o)

På forhånd mange tak for din hjælp

Mvh Maiken

Mozilla/4.0 (compatible; MSIE 7.0; Windows NT 5.1; GTB6.5; .NET CLR 2.0.50727; .NET CLR 3.0.4506.2152; .NET CLR 3.5.30729; InfoPath.2)

Kim Ludvigsen
MozillaDanmark
 
Indlæg: 11583
Tilmeldt: lør 5. mar 2005 22:45

Re: Skabelon, css og at linke

Indlægaf Kim Ludvigsen » fre 13. aug 2010 10:24

maikenjh skrev: jeg startede nemlig med at overskrive igen og igen, så der lærte jeg lidt


Ja, man skal altid vælge Filer => Gem som STRAKS efter indlæsningen. Reelt kan man vente, men så risikerer man meget nemt at komme til at klikke på Gem, og så overskrives den originale side.

maikenjh skrev: Nu har jeg så rettet i teksten i tre sider og er kommet i tanke om at det måske var en god ide at bruge css idet jeg f.eks. ønsker at skabelonen på alle sider er en smule bredere. Er det her jeg skal bruge ekstern css og kan jeg bruge det efter jeg har rettet/ lavet teksten til de første tre sider?


Ja, det er det smarte ved eksternt css, du kan rette samtlige sider ved at rette lidt i css-filen. Hvis du bruger en af mine skabeloner, har du allerede et eksternt css.

Jeg bør dog lige tilføje, at hvis du på en side har tilføjet interne css-stile på en boks, vil den have forrang for css-filen. Og så skal du ind og rette manuelt på den pågældende side.

maikenjh skrev: Er der et sted hvor jeg kan lære om brugen af css til skabeloner/ og andre sider?


http://kimludvigsen.dk/programmer-inter ... in-css.php :D
Der er ingen forskel på brugen af eksternt css på én side og mange sider.

maikenjh skrev: Ud over det så har jeg problemer med at linke siderne til hinanden. Kan det passe at i den rullemenu der popper op (når jeg prøver at linke) ikke indeholder de andre sider? Siderne er jo også gemt seperat, så det er vel ikke lige sådan for Kompozer at finde dem.


Du har helt ret i din formodning, KompoZer holder ikke øje med seperate sider, så du skal selv indtaste det ønskede filnavn. Rullemenuen er beregnet til interne links (ankre) og dem holder KompoZer øje med. KompoZer laver endda automatisk ankre til overskrifter på siden.

maikenjh skrev: Du skriver på Ludvigs hjørne at: "Ankre kan også benyttes, når du linker til en anden side. I så fald skal du skrive adressen på siden, efterfulgt af # og ankrets navn. Linket kan fx se sådan ud: http://kimludvigsen.dk/tips-internet-we ... hp#firefox. .....Men jeg har jo ikke noget navn til hjemmesiden endnu, betyder det så at jeg skal vente med at linke til den er oprettet? (Husk at jeg er HELT grøn :o)


Du er sprunget over et af de allerførste punkter, når du vil lave en hjemmeside: Lav et sitemap.

Når du har et sitemap over de ønskede sider, så vælger du blot et filnavn for hver enkelt side og skriver det på sitemappet, og så bruger du bare det filnavn, når du skal lave links. Dermed kan du lave linkene, selvom du endnu ikke har lavet de andre sider.

Man behøver selvfølgelig ikke at lave et sitemap, men kan nøjes med at "opfinde" filnavne, efterhånden som man skal bruge links, og så skal man blot huske at give den næste side det pågældende navn. Men et sitemap gør det hele mere overskueligt.

Ankre på en anden side er typisk til en overskrift på den anden side, så i det tilfælde skal du både kende navnet på den næste side og ankret på den pågældende overskrift. KompoZer laver som sagt automatisk ankre til overskrifter, men dem kan du nok ikke gætte navnet på på forhånd. I stedet kan du bare "opfinde" et ankernavn, og så påføre det manuelt på den ønskede overskrift på den næste side.

Jeg håber, jeg har forklaret tydeligt nok, ellers må du bare spørge igen.
Mvh. Kim

maikenjh
 

Re: Skabelon, css og at linke

Indlægaf maikenjh » fre 13. aug 2010 13:05

Mange tak for dine fine svar - det hjælper mig meget.

Jeg kan dog stadig ikke få siderne til at linke til hinaden. Jeg har valgt at lave en kope af hele min website mappe engang imellem for at have en sikkerhed hvis det går galt for mig. Tror det var det der gjorde at mine sider kom til at indeholde en eller flere %20 (f.eks 2%20Mei%20tai.html, når den reelt hedder 2 Mei tai.html)??? Jeg har nu omdøbt til f.eks. 2meitai.html og de er der ikke mere. MEN efter at have lavet linket som du beskrev kan jeg stadig ikke se om det virker. Der sker intet når jeg trykker på det, men jeg skal måske bare stole på at det virker?

Jeg vil gerne have en kontakt side på min hjemmeside, hvor de besøgende kan sende mig en mail/besked/bestilling. Hvordan gør jeg det? Er det mon et program jeg skal tilføje?

Jeg er som sagt helt grøn i html og kodning, men vil rigtig gerne have bare en minimal chance for at komme på google. Jeg har læst en del om søgemaskineoptimering og har prøvet at målrette mine overskrifter og tekst til den rigtige målgruppe. Jeg kan dog ikke finde ud af hvor jeg mon kan indføre relevante keywords?

Mvh Maiken (som syr Mei tai bæreseler på hyggebasis)

Kim Ludvigsen
MozillaDanmark
 
Indlæg: 11583
Tilmeldt: lør 5. mar 2005 22:45

Re: Skabelon, css og at linke

Indlægaf Kim Ludvigsen » fre 13. aug 2010 13:53

maikenjh skrev: Jeg kan dog stadig ikke få siderne til at linke til hinaden. Jeg har valgt at lave en kope af hele min website mappe engang imellem for at have en sikkerhed hvis det går galt for mig.


Det er en rigtig god ide!

maikenjh skrev: Tror det var det der gjorde at mine sider kom til at indeholde en eller flere %20 (f.eks 2%20Mei%20tai.html, når den reelt hedder 2 Mei tai.html)???


Nej, det er fordi, du bruger mellemrum i filnavne. Den slags skal du undgå, brug i stedet - (bindestreg). Du skal også undgå de specielle danske bogstaver æ, ø og å.

maikenjh skrev: MEN efter at have lavet linket som du beskrev kan jeg stadig ikke se om det virker. Der sker intet når jeg trykker på det, men jeg skal måske bare stole på at det virker?


Linket vil ikke virke i KompoZer, fordi det er et redigeringsprogram. Prøv at åbne siden i en browser som fx Internet Explorer eller Firefox, så skulle det gerne virke.

maikenjh skrev: Jeg vil gerne have en kontakt side på min hjemmeside, hvor de besøgende kan sende mig en mail/besked/bestilling. Hvordan gør jeg det? Er det mon et program jeg skal tilføje?


Det allernemmeste er, at du blot skriver din mailadresse. Du kan risikere, at det også vil resultere i lidt mere spam, men kan de fleste moderne mailprogrammer sagtens håndtere.

Man kan lave avancerede løsninger med en kontaktformular, men så begynder det at blive mere nørdet. Jeg har skrevet lidt om php, som er en af de metoder, man kan bruge (det afhænger af webhotellet). Jeg har endda lavet en færdig formular, som blot skal tilrettes lidt:
http://kimludvigsen.dk/programmer-inter ... in-php.php

Men i første omgang, så prøv at koncentrere dig om at få siderne færdige, så kan du altid tilføje en kontaktformular senere, hvis du har mod på det.

maikenjh skrev: Jeg er som sagt helt grøn i html og kodning, men vil rigtig gerne have bare en minimal chance for at komme på google. Jeg har læst en del om søgemaskineoptimering og har prøvet at målrette mine overskrifter og tekst til den rigtige målgruppe. Jeg kan dog ikke finde ud af hvor jeg mon kan indføre relevante keywords?


Man kan indsætte keywords i sidens header, og i internettets barndom var den slags vigtige for søgemaskinerne. Men det blev misbrugt, så de fleste søgemaskiner ignorer den slags keywords i vore dage.

Når man i dag snakker om keywords, er det blot, at man bruger nøgleord i sine tekster. Altså de ord, man gerne vil kunne findes under i Google. De vigtigste ord bør også bruges i sidens titel (den der vises i titelbjælken i browseren), filens navn (bortset fra forsiden, der skal hedde index.html) og i overskrifter, hvor den vigtigste er overskrift1 (h1).

Du kan selv tilmelde din side til Google og de andre søgemaskiner, men det kan tage nogle måneder, før den bliver indekseret. Det allerbedste er at få en allerede indekseret side til at linke til din side, så indekseres den hurtigere.
Mvh. Kim